.g-container{position:relative;z-index:0}.g-container:before{background:url(//8788893.fs1.hubspotusercontent-na1.net/hubfs/8788893/raw_assets/public/mt2020/assets/images/blog/sky-bg.jpg) no-repeat 50%;background-size:cover;content:"";display:block;height:100vh;left:0;position:fixed;top:0;width:100%;z-index:-1}.g-header.-blog{background-color:#fff}@media screen and (max-width:767px){.g-header.-blog .logo{width:20rem}}.g-header.-blog .logo img{display:block}.g-header.-blog .gnav-overlay,.g-header.-blog .toggle-btn{background-color:#031c8c}.g-footer{border-color:#474747}.col2-container{margin-top:3.2rem}@media screen and (min-width:768px){.col2-container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;margin-top:4.8rem}.col2-container .main-content{width:76.73%}.col2-container .sidebar{width:18.182%}}@media screen and (max-width:767px){.col2-container .sidebar{margin:8.8rem auto 0;max-width:400px}}.col2-container .sidebar .hs_cos_wrapper:not(:first-child){margin-top:6.4rem}.col2-container .sidebar img{width:100%}.m-breadcrumb{color:#fff}.post-listing{display:grid;gap:3.2rem;grid-template-columns:repeat(2,1fr)}@media screen and (min-width:768px){.post-listing.-col3{gap:2.8rem;grid-template-columns:repeat(3,1fr)}}@media screen and (max-width:767px){.post-listing{gap:2.4rem;grid-template-columns:repeat(1,1fr)}}.post-item{background-color:#fff;border-radius:8px;padding:2.6rem 2.4rem 1.6rem;position:relative}@media screen and (max-width:767px){.post-item{padding:1.6rem}}.post-item .post-link{height:100%;left:0;position:absolute;top:0;width:100%;z-index:2}.post-item .new{background-color:#f04848;border-radius:4px;color:#fff;font-family:"U.S. 101",sans-serif;left:1.6rem;line-height:1;padding:.5rem 1rem;position:absolute;top:1.8rem;z-index:1}@media screen and (max-width:767px){.post-item .new{border-radius:2px;font-size:1.2rem;left:1.2rem;top:1.2rem}}.post-item .thumb{aspect-ratio:16/9;background-color:#eee;border-radius:4px;margin:0 0 1rem;overflow:hidden;position:relative}.post-item .thumb img{height:100%;left:0;position:absolute;top:0;-webkit-transition:-webkit-transform .3s;transition:-webkit-transform .3s;transition:transform .3s;transition:transform .3s,-webkit-transform .3s;width:100%}.post-item .title{font-size:1.6rem;margin:0 0 1.6rem}@media screen and (max-width:767px){.post-item .title{margin-bottom:1rem}}.post-item .title-line{background-image:-webkit-gradient(linear,left top,right top,from(#2d7de6),to(#2d7de6));background-image:linear-gradient(90deg,#2d7de6,#2d7de6);background-position:0 100%;background-repeat:no-repeat;background-size:0 1px;-webkit-transition:background-size .5s,color .3s;transition:background-size .5s,color .3s}.post-item .tag-group{gap:.8rem;margin:0 0 .8rem}.post-item .tag{position:relative;z-index:3}.post-item .post-meta{gap:1.8rem;margin:1rem 0 0}.post-item:hover .thumb img{-webkit-transform:scale(1.05);transform:scale(1.05)}.post-item:hover .title-line{background-size:100% 1px;color:#2d7de6}.tag-group{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:1.2rem}@media screen and (max-width:767px){.tag-group{gap:1rem}}.tag{background-color:rgba(0,0,0,.05);border-radius:1.7rem;color:#817e7e;display:block;font-size:1.2rem;line-height:1.3;padding:.5rem 1rem;text-decoration:none;-webkit-transition:background .3s,color .3s;transition:background .3s,color .3s}.tag:hover{background-color:#2d7de6;color:#fff;opacity:1}.post-meta{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-align:center;-ms-flex-align:center;align-items:center;font-size:1.4rem;gap:2.4rem;margin:0 0 2.4rem}@media screen and (max-width:767px){.post-meta{font-size:1.2rem;margin-bottom:2rem}}.post-meta .date{color:#a7a7a7}.post-meta a{color:inherit}.bottom-contact{background-color:#013c8c;margin-top:9.6rem;padding:3.2rem 0}@media screen and (min-width:768px){.bottom-contact{padding:8rem 20px}.bottom-contact .m-button-container .button-item a{height:100px}}.bottom-contact .m-button-container .button-item:first-child{margin-top:0}.bottom-contact .m-button-container .button-item.-blue a{background-color:#2d7de6}.listing-tag-container{margin:6.4rem 0 7.2rem}@media screen and (max-width:767px){.listing-tag-container{margin-bottom:6.6rem;margin-top:4.8rem}.listing-tag-container .tag-group{gap:.8rem}}.listing-tag-container .tag{background-color:rgba(0,0,0,.5);color:#fff;font-size:1.4rem;padding:.8rem 1.6rem}@media screen and (max-width:767px){.listing-tag-container .tag{font-size:1.2rem}}.listing-tag-container .tag:hover{background-color:#2d7de6}.listing-container h2{color:#fff;font-size:1.8rem;letter-spacing:.11em;margin-bottom:1.6rem}@media screen and (max-width:767px){.listing-container h2{font-size:1.4rem;margin-bottom:1.2rem}}.listing-container .main-content h2{font-size:2.2rem;line-height:1.6;margin-bottom:3.2rem}@media screen and (max-width:767px){.listing-container .main-content h2{font-size:1.8rem;margin-bottom:2.2rem}}.listing-container .main-content h2:after{background-color:currentColor;border-radius:3px;content:"";display:block;height:.3rem;margin-top:1.2rem;width:5.4rem}.post-data{background-color:#fff;border-radius:8px;line-height:1.6;padding:3.2rem 3.2rem 6.4rem}@media screen and (max-width:767px){.post-data{font-size:1.5rem;padding:1.6rem 1.6rem 4rem}}.post-data .featured-image{margin-bottom:2.5rem;text-align:center}@media screen and (max-width:767px){.post-data .featured-image{margin-bottom:1.6rem}}.post-data .featured-image img{border-radius:4px}.post-data .tag-group{margin:0}.post-data .post-body{margin-top:4rem}@media screen and (min-width:768px){.post-data .post-body{letter-spacing:.04em;margin-top:4.8rem}}.post-data h1{font-size:2.8rem;margin:0 0 .8rem}@media screen and (max-width:767px){.post-data h1{font-size:2.4rem}}.post-data h2{font-size:2.4rem;margin:6.4rem 0 3.6rem}@media screen and (max-width:767px){.post-data h2{font-size:2.2rem;margin-bottom:2.8rem}}.post-data h2:after{background-color:#2d7de6;border-radius:3px;content:"";display:block;height:2px;margin-top:1.2rem;width:5.4rem}.post-data h3{font-size:2rem;margin:4.8rem 0 3.2rem;padding-left:2.8rem;position:relative}@media screen and (max-width:767px){.post-data h3{font-size:2rem;margin-bottom:2.4rem;padding-left:2.4rem}}.post-data h3:before{background-color:#2d7de6;border-radius:3px;content:"";display:block;height:1.6rem;left:0;position:absolute;top:calc(.8em - .8rem);width:1.6rem}@media screen and (max-width:767px){.post-data h3:before{height:1.2rem;top:calc(.8em - .6rem);width:1.2rem}}.post-data h4{color:#2d7de6;font-size:1.8rem;margin:4.8rem 0 3.2rem}@media screen and (max-width:767px){.post-data h4{margin-bottom:2rem;margin-top:4rem}}.post-data h5{font-size:1.7rem;margin:4rem 0 2rem;padding-left:1.9rem;position:relative}.post-data h5:before{background-color:#2d7de6;border-radius:3px;content:"";display:block;height:1.35em;left:0;position:absolute;top:0;width:.3rem}.post-data h6{font-size:1.6rem;margin:2.8rem 0 1.6rem;padding-left:2.2rem;position:relative}.post-data h6:before{aspect-ratio:1/1;border:1px solid #2d7de6;border-radius:50%;content:"";display:block;left:0;position:absolute;top:calc(.75em - .5rem);width:1rem}.post-data table{border:none}.post-data table td,.post-data table th{border:1px solid #dbdbdb;padding:1.2rem;text-align:left;vertical-align:top}.post-data table th{background-color:#f7f8f9;font-weight:700}@media screen and (min-width:768px){.post-data table td{font-size:1.4rem}}.post-data hr{border:none;border-top:1px solid #dbdbdb}.post-data blockquote{background-color:#f7f8f9;border-radius:4px;color:#72839a;font-family:inherit;margin:1em 0;padding:1.6rem 1.6rem 1.6rem 2.8rem;position:relative}@media screen and (min-width:768px){.post-data blockquote{font-size:1.4rem;padding:2.4rem 2.4rem 2.4rem 3.6rem}}.post-data blockquote:before{background-color:#72839a;border-radius:2px;content:"";display:block;height:calc(100% - 3.2rem);left:1.6rem;position:absolute;top:1.6rem;width:.4rem}@media screen and (min-width:768px){.post-data blockquote:before{height:calc(100% - 4.8rem);left:2.4rem;top:2.4rem}}.post-data pre{background-color:#f5f5f5;border-radius:4px;font-family:inherit;font-size:1.4rem;padding:1.6rem;white-space:pre-wrap;word-break:break-all}@media screen and (min-width:768px){.post-data pre{font-size:1.4rem;padding:2.4rem}}.post-data blockquote:last-child,.post-data pre:last-child{margin-bottom:0}.post-data h1,.post-data h2,.post-data h3,.post-data h4,.post-data h5,.post-data h6{font-weight:700;letter-spacing:normal;line-height:1.6}.post-data h1+*,.post-data h1:first-child,.post-data h2+*,.post-data h2:first-child,.post-data h3+*,.post-data h3:first-child,.post-data h4+*,.post-data h4:first-child,.post-data h5+*,.post-data h5:first-child,.post-data h6+*,.post-data h6:first-child{margin-top:0}.post-data h1:last-child,.post-data h2:last-child,.post-data h3:last-child,.post-data h4:last-child,.post-data h5:last-child,.post-data h6:last-child{margin-bottom:0}.listing-button{margin-top:5.2rem;text-align:center}@media screen and (max-width:767px){.listing-button{margin-top:4.8rem}}.listing-button a{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;position:relative;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;background-color:rgba(0,0,0,.5);color:#fff;font-weight:700;justify-content:center;line-height:1.3;max-width:100%;min-height:5rem;padding:.8rem 3rem .6rem;text-decoration:none;-webkit-transition:background-color .3s;transition:background-color .3s;width:35rem}@media screen and (max-width:767px){.listing-button a{width:auto}}.listing-button a:before{border-left:2px solid #fff;border-top:2px solid #fff;content:"";display:block;height:10px;left:2.4rem;margin-top:-6px;position:absolute;top:50%;-webkit-transform:rotate(-45deg);transform:rotate(-45deg);width:10px}@media screen and (max-width:767px){.listing-button a:before{left:1.2rem}}.listing-button a:hover{background-color:#2d7de6;opacity:1}.Author{background-color:#fff;border:1.5px solid #000;border-radius:8px;line-height:1.6;margin-top:8rem;padding:1rem 3.2rem;position:relative}.Author:after,.Author:before{clear:both;content:"";display:block}.author-title{background:#000;border:2px solid #000;border-radius:8px;color:#fff;display:inline-block;font-size:2rem;font-weight:700;left:0;padding:0 10px;position:absolute;top:-35px}.author-avatar{border-radius:50%;display:block;float:left;height:100px;margin:0 20px 7px 10px;width:100px}.author-link{color:#000;font-size:20px;font-weight:bolder;margin:0 0 4px;padding:0}.author-bio{font-size:15px;line-height:1.6;margin:4px 0 0;overflow:hidden;padding:0}